After a year of ownership I finally got around to fully detailing the exterior of my car. It was a 2 day process. Clay Mitt, Medium Cut, Finishing Polish, and 2 coats of Gyeon Ceramic Can Coat.
The metallic pops out strong and the gloss is excellent. Its unlike me to own a car this long and not detail it so to see how well it turned out is hard for me to believe.

For the first time since acquiring the ZHP back in 2017, and perhaps for the first time in its 103k mile life, I cleaned the alcantara steering wheel. I used genuine BMW alcantara fabric cleaner and a tooth brush. The grime I cleaned off from the wheel turned 2 buckets of water black, and fouled up a few microfiber cloths, but I think I have restored the wheel to its former glory.
The only thing I realized though, is that I am not sure if I like the feeling of an alcantara steering wheel. Even after all this, I think I want to get it changed to regular leather. Maybe I need to give it some time...
